当前位置:首页chatgptchatgpt 翻译

chatgpt 翻译

使用ChatGPT进行机器翻译

介绍

ChatGPT是一个基于大规模预训练语言模型的对话生成平台。它可以用于语音识别、机器翻译和自然语言处理等领域。本文将介绍如何使用ChatGPT来进行机器翻译的步骤和技巧。

ChatGPT的原理

ChatGPT使用的是GPT(Generative Pre-training Transformer)模型,它是由OpenAI开发的一种基于Transformer网络的序列到序列模型。GPT模型在进行预训练时使用了非常大的数据集,可以捕捉到很多不同语言的语法规则和常见表达方式。

使用ChatGPT进行机器翻译的步骤

以下是使用ChatGPT进行机器翻译的基本步骤:

准备数据集:首先,需要准备一份包含需要翻译的语言对的数据集。数据集应该包含一个源语言和一个目标语言的文本对,每个文本对应一个翻译关系。

清洗和预处理数据:接下来,需要对数据进行清洗和预处理。清洗数据的目的是去除不必要的标点符号、空格和其他噪声。预处理数据的目的是将文本编码为数字,以便输入模型进行处理。

训练模型:在准备好数据后,需要使用ChatGPT模型进行训练。在训练过程中,模型将在大量的训练数据上进行学习。为了获得更好的翻译质量,通常需要进行多轮的训练。

评估和优化模型:训练完成后,需要对模型进行评估和优化。评估模型的目的是确定模型在不同测试集上的表现如何。优化模型的目的是根据评估结果,找到最佳的参数组合和超参数。

使用模型进行翻译:最后,需要使用训练好的模型进行翻译。在翻译时,会将源语言的文本输入到模型中,并输出目标语言的文本。

优化ChatGPT模型的技巧

以下是可以使用的一些技巧来优化ChatGPT模型的翻译质量:

增加训练数据:增加训练数据可以让模型更好地学习各种语言规则和表达方式。可以从不同来源(例如网站、书籍和社交媒体)收集数据,并进行去重和清洗。

使用更高级别的Token:在预处理数据时,可以使用更高级别的Token(例如子词)来代替单词。这可以帮助模型处理未知单词和常见表达方式的变体。

进行数据增强:通过使用数据增强技术,可以生成更多的训练数据,如将文本进行轻微的修改和变换。这可以增加模型的泛??能力,提高模型的翻译质量。

使用更好的评估指标:传统的BLEU指标在翻译长文本时可能不足够准确。可以使用更先进的指标(如METEOR和TER)来评估模型在不同测试集上的表现。

使用集成模型:使用多个模型的集成可以提高翻译质量。可以使用不同的预训练模型(如GPT-2和BERT)或不同的训练数据来训练多个模型,并将它们的输出进行融合。

结论

使用ChatGPT进行机器翻译是一项有趣的任务。虽然它不能完全替代人工翻译,但它可以帮助我们快速翻译大量文本,并为跨语言沟通提供支持。希望本文对您有所帮助。

温馨提示:

文章标题:chatgpt 翻译

文章链接:https://yuntunft.cn/8960.html

更新时间:2024年09月26日

给TA打赏
共{{data.count}}人
人已打赏
个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索